Output 051629ec6060fb5a78992c6c6c3fccbbb097b51a869b02f19d0daa7581916966:1

value
1010509
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5ad15d4615ebec16a27a18e9e10373c9a670236 OP_EQUALVERIFY OP_CHECKSIG
address
1LUpH346yjy6gb6Jx2JntJQoZoRpMxG1Ei
transaction
051629ec6060fb5a78992c6c6c3fccbbb097b51a869b02f19d0daa7581916966
spent
true